The grant opportunity titled "CONSVERATION LAW ENFORCEMENT OFFICER (CLEO) SUPPORT" (Funding Opportunity Number: NWO CESU 17 33) is a Department of Defense-funded cooperative agreement focused on providing conservation-oriented law enforcement services across multiple U.S. Air Force installations in Florida. The work is tied to environmental stewardship and natural resource protection on military-managed lands, specifically at Avon Park Air Force Range, Eglin Air Force Base, Tyndall Air Force Base, MacDill Air Force Base, Patrick Air Force Base, and Cape Canaveral Air Force Station. The underlying need described is for professional patrol and surveillance capacity to help the Air Force manage and protect these large, often heavily used properties.
The project centers on Conservation Law Enforcement Officer support, meaning the awardee would supply personnel capable of conducting routine patrols and surveillance of designated areas and of engaging directly with people using those lands and resources. A major portion of the role involves making contact with resource users (for example, individuals accessing management areas for authorized recreation or other permitted activities), monitoring compliance, and addressing unlawful or unsafe behaviors. The enforcement component is explicitly framed around both applicable conservation laws and Air Force regulations, indicating that officers must be able to apply relevant state and/or federal conservation protections alongside installation-specific rules governing access, hunting/fishing where applicable, wildlife protection, habitat protection, restricted areas, and general conduct on Air Force property.
From an administrative standpoint, the opportunity was listed under the discretionary category and uses a cooperative agreement as the funding instrument, which typically implies a more collaborative relationship with the government than a standard grant, often including substantial involvement by the agency in coordinating, guiding, or overseeing performance. The funding activity category is Environment, and the CFDA number provided is 12.632, aligning the effort with broader defense environmental and natural resources management priorities. The issuing agency is the Department of Defense, Omaha District, which indicates management through that district office for this particular award.
In terms of scale and competitiveness, the opportunity anticipated a single award (Expected Awards: 1) with an award ceiling of $760,000. Eligibility was broadly described as "Others (see text field entitled Additional Information on Eligibility for clarification)," which suggests that the eligible applicant pool may have been limited or defined by additional criteria not included in the excerpt, such as membership in a specific cooperative ecosystem studies unit (CESU) network or other partnership framework. Key timing details show the posting date as July 21, 2017, with an original closing date of August 22, 2017, indicating a roughly one-month application window.
Overall, the opportunity is best understood as funding for boots-on-the-ground conservation enforcement support across several major Florida Air Force installations, intended to strengthen patrol presence, ensure compliance with conservation and installation rules, and support responsible public or authorized user interaction with sensitive management lands.
